Job Description
We are seeking a Payroll Specialist to support payroll operations in a banking environment. This role is responsible for ensuring accurate, timely payroll processing while maintaining confidentiality and compliance with regulatory standards.
Key Responsibilities:
Part of a team that processes bi-weekly payroll, including time and attendance verification Maintain accurate, confidential payroll records in compliance with internal controls Respond to employee payroll inquiries and provide excellent service Reconcile payroll reports and resolve discrepancies Prepare reports for Finance, HR, and audits Assist with deductions, garnishments, tax filings, and year-end processing (W-2s)Qualifications:
Associate Degree in Accounting, Finance, Business, or related field preferred 2+ years of payroll, accounting, or administrative experience Strong attention to detail and accuracy Knowledge of payroll regulations, taxes, and internal controls Proficiency in Microsoft Office; strong Excel skills preferred Strong communication and customer service skills Experience with payroll systems (ADP, UKG, Paychex, etc.) preferred Ability to handle sensitive information with discretion The above statements are intended to describe the general nature and level of work to be performed by personnel assigned to this job.
